@charset "utf-8";

/* CSS Document */

*{margin:0px; padding:0px; }

a{text-decoration:none; color:#686868;}

a:hover{text-decoration:underline;}

li{list-style-type:none;}

img{border:0px;}

.fl{float:left;}

.fr{float:right;}

.cl{clear:both;}

.no{display:none;}

.he{overflow:hidden; !important overflow:auto; zoom:1;}

.xw{width:980px; padding:0 20px; margin:0 auto; text-align:center;}

.tw{width:980px; padding:0 20px; margin:0 auto; background:#fff;}

.mb20{margin-bottom:20px;}



body{background:#ece0b7;font:12px/20px "微软雅黑", Arial, Helvetica, sans-serif;}

.top{width:100%; background:#a28e4a; height:51px;}

.top ul{float:right;}

.top li{float:left; width:86px; height:20px; margin:16px 0 0;}

.top li a{background:url(../images/shou.jpg) no-repeat; padding-left:24px; color:#fbf5c9;}

.top li.t2 a{background-image:url(../images/tlian.jpg);}

.top li.t3 a{background-image:url(../images/tcang.jpg);}

.ban{width:100%; height:549px; margin-bottom:10px;}

.ban li{background:url(../images/ban1.jpg) no-repeat center; height:183px; width:100%;}

.ban li.ban2{background-image:url(../images/ban2.jpg);}

.ban li.ban3{background-image:url(../images/ban3.jpg);}

.bans{width:970px; margin:0 auto; height:48px; padding:83px 0 0;}

.bans a{width:126px; height:48px; float:right; display:inline; margin-right:36px;}

.xin{padding:20px 0 0; height:300px;}

.xinl{background:url(../images/xinl.jpg) no-repeat 7px 7px; border:1px #dadada solid; padding:7px; width:386px; height:256px; display:inline; margin-right:25px;}

.xinh{color:#8a6b00; line-height:79px; font-size:24px; text-indent:55px;}

.xint{color:#8a6b00; padding-left:22px; margin-bottom:20px; font-size:20px;font-family:"宋体";}

.xint span{color:#fff; background:#8a6b00; padding:0 5px;}

.xin p{text-indent:2em; margin-bottom:25px;}

.xin p b{color:#c58b24;}

.tai{float:left; width:319px; display:inline; margin-right:10px; line-height:22px; height:390px;}

.tai img{margin-bottom:25px;}

.tai p{text-indent:2em; line-height:22px; padding:10px 0 0;}

.tai p.taip1{padding:0 50px 0 0;}

.tai b{color:#c58b24;}

.kh{background:url(../images/khb.jpg) repeat-x center; height:70px; padding:10px 0 0;}

.kh span{ font-size:25px; color:#8a6b00; background:#fff; padding:0px 10px 0 0; font-weight:bold; font-family:"宋体";}

.ks li{float:left; display:inline; /*width:324px;*/ width:242px; height:39px; margin:0 3px 5px 0; text-align:center; background:#d1c59b; color:#8a6b00; cursor:pointer; line-height:39px; font-weight:bold; font-size:16px;}

.ks li.hover{color:#503e00; background:#b19c54;}

.kk{height:auto; margin-bottom:20px;}

.ke{border:2px solid #d1c59b; background:url(../images/ke1.jpg) no-repeat 0 36px;font-family:"宋体";}

.keh td{text-align:center; background:#ebe4cb; color:#8a6b00; font-weight:bold; height:38px; line-height:38px;}

.kecd td{height:40px; line-height:40px; text-indent:50px; font-weight:bold; color:#404040; }
.kecd td a{color:#ef4000;}

.kec td{height:39px; line-height:39px; text-indent:50px; font-weight:bold; color:#404040;}
.kec td a{color:#ef4000;}

.ke td i{padding-left:15px; font-weight:100; font-style:normal;}

.ke td span{color:#c4b57f; padding-right:20px;}



.ke4{background:url(../images/ke9.png) 0px 39px;}

.kl{float:left; width:220px; display:inline; margin-right:33px; height:300px;}

.klt{background:url(../images/ktl.jpg); height:40px; line-height:40px; text-align:center; color:#8a6b00; font-size:14px; margin-bottom:25px; font-weight:bold;}

.kl p{padding:0 15px; line-height:23px;}

.wts{background:url(../images/wts.jpg) no-repeat; padding:0 0 0 80px; line-height:25px; color:#8a6b00; font-size:14px; height:120px;}
.wts p a{text-decoration:none; color:#8a6b00;}

.bt{text-indent:2em; font-size:14px; line-height:25px; height:75px;}

.tab td{text-align:center; background:#fbf8ec; font-size:14px; font-family:"宋体";}

.tab td.mcbh{color:#8a6b00;}

.tab td.mcb{padding-left:85px; text-align:left;}

.mcc i{padding-left:30px;}

.mcc i.tabc{padding-left:40px;}

.yue{position:relative; color:#8a6b00; line-height:25px; height:176px; padding:30px 0;}

.yueh{font-weight:bold; font-size:14px;}

.yue p b{color:#df7a03; font-size:14px;}

.tzz{position:absolute; bottom:34px; right:272px;}

.tyy{position:absolute; bottom:34px; right:74px;}

.lam{background:url(../images/lam.jpg); padding:0 25px; height:122px; line-height:25px; font-size:14px; text-indent:2em; margin-bottom:40px;font-family:"宋体";}

.lamh{line-height:55px; font-weight:bold; font-size:20px; color:#8a6b00; text-align:center;}

.kh b{float:right; display:inline; margin:45px 20px 0 0; font-weight:100; color:#8a6b00; font-size:14px;}

.zjl{float:left; width:650px;}

.zjl .zji{float:left; border:1px #dadada solid; padding:2px; }

.zjh{line-height:60px; font-size:20px; font-weight:bold; color:#c5b580; border-bottom:1px #c5b580 solid;}

.zjt{line-height:35px; color:#c5b580; border-bottom:1px #c5b580 solid; font-size:16px;}

.zjc{padding:20px 0 0; line-height:20px; height:194px; font-size:14px; line-height:25px;}

.zjlr{width:272px; float:right;}

.zj{height:390px;}

.zj ul{float:right; width:301px; border:#d1c59b 1px solid; padding:6px 0;}

.zj li{float:left; position:relative; width:134px; height:110px; background:#fbf9f2; font-size:14px; color:#544206; display:inline; margin:0 0px 5px 10px; cursor:pointer;}

.zj li img{float:left; display:inline; margin-right:5px;}

.zj li i{position:absolute; top:0; left:0; filter: alpha(opacity=40);

 filter: progid:DXImageTransform.Microsoft.Alpha(opacity=40); opacity:0.40;

 -webkit-transition: all 0.6s ease-in-out; background:#ece0b7; width:134px; height:110px;}

.zj li span{display:block; height:20px;}

.zj li.hover i{display:none;}

.tb{height:15px; width:100%;}

.foot{background:url(../images/foot.jpg); height:139px; width:100%;color:#fbf5c9;}

.foot a{color:#fbf5c9;}

.foot .fl{display:inline; margin-right:20px;}

.fla{height:38px; padding:25px 0 0; color:#fbf5c9;}

.fla a{margin:0 10px; color:#fbf5c9; font-weight:bold;}

.fw{float:right; background:url(../images/fw.jpg) no-repeat; width:81px; height:23px; padding:83px 0 0; text-align:center; margin:20px 30px 0 0;}